Overview
The ideal candidate will have experience in iOS application development and be proficient in Java, Objective C, Swift, or similar technologies.
* Key Responsibilities:
* You will work within our team on end-to-end system designs and development across mobile applications, including Pingit and client's Mobile banking.
* This will involve both business-as-usual projects and exciting R&D/Innovation initiatives using various programming languages and frameworks.
* As a mobile developer within iOS, you will work collaboratively with a like-minded team of Solution architects, UI/UX designers, and fellow developers to produce high-quality code.
Requirements
* iOS application development with Java, Objective C, Swift, or similar technologies.
* Xcode proficiency.
* Experience with continuous deployment tools such as Gradle or Jenkins.
* Familiarity with Git version control.
* Ability to test own code and perform unit testing.
* Demonstrable experience working in an agile team following Scrum methods.
* Proven track record of working to modern development methods such as TDD or BDD.
Desirable Skills:
* Front-end development skills in HTML, CSS, JavaScript.
* Additional skills in languages including C, C++, Scala, Kotlin, Python, or Ruby.
About the Role
This is a fantastic opportunity for an experienced iOS developer to join our team and contribute to the development of innovative mobile solutions.